Purchasing A Macbook Online Through The Apple Education Store?

I went with my friend to get her mac in the store but i would have to drive 2.5 hrs to get there and with gas prices the way they are i would rather just buy it online.
How does it work when you are buying it with the education discount online. How do i prove that i am a college student? Do they just ask me for my student number or something?
Anyone done this?

    When you log in to the Apple education store, they ask you what city & state your college is in and then which college you are going to. You just check it. Apple will usually contact your college to make sure you are a student or they may ask you for a copy of your I.D. When I bought my first Mac, they phoned my principal to make sure I was a teacher at the school. After that, they didn’t bother and just trusted me. I now have an iMac and a MacBook. Both work flawlessly. You’ll get free shipping and an iPod Nano as a college student.

    If I remember correctly you will need a photocopy of your class schedule or a copy of your college ID. You will still have to pay your states sales tax and shipping unless they have a free shipping promotion.
